跨部署微服务平台年末促销可能指的是在年底时,针对使用跨部署微服务架构的企业或开发者提供的优惠活动。以下是关于跨部署微服务平台的基础概念、优势、类型、应用场景以及促销活动可能带来的影响和相关问题的解答。
基础概念
跨部署微服务平台是指支持在不同环境(如本地数据中心、公有云、私有云等)上部署和管理微服务的平台。它提供了一套统一的开发和运维工具,使得开发者可以轻松地在多个环境中构建、部署和维护微服务。
优势
- 灵活性:支持多种部署环境,适应不同的业务需求和合规要求。
- 可扩展性:易于添加新服务和资源,以应对业务增长。
- 高可用性:通过分布式架构和冗余设计,提高系统的整体可用性。
- 易于维护:集中化的管理和监控工具简化了服务的维护工作。
类型
- 基于云的微服务平台:完全运行在云环境中,提供弹性和按需付费的优势。
- 混合微服务平台:结合了本地和云环境的优势,适用于需要兼顾性能和安全性的场景。
- 边缘微服务平台:专注于在网络边缘部署微服务,以减少延迟和提高响应速度。
应用场景
- 电商网站:处理大量并发请求,确保购物高峰期的系统稳定性。
- 金融服务:满足严格的合规性和安全性要求,同时提供高效的服务交付。
- 物联网应用:支持大量设备的连接和管理,实现实时数据处理和分析。
年末促销的影响
年末促销通常会带来以下影响:
- 成本效益:通过折扣和优惠活动,降低企业采用新技术的门槛。
- 市场推广:增加平台的知名度和用户基数。
- 技术采纳:鼓励更多企业尝试和采用跨部署微服务架构。
可能遇到的问题及解决方案
问题1:促销活动期间服务稳定性如何保证?
解决方案:
- 提前进行容量规划和性能测试,确保系统能够应对增加的流量。
- 实施自动扩展策略,根据实时负载动态调整资源分配。
- 加强监控和告警机制,及时发现并解决潜在问题。
问题2:如何确保数据在不同环境间的安全传输?
解决方案:
- 使用加密技术(如TLS)保护数据在传输过程中的安全。
- 实施严格的数据访问控制和权限管理。
- 定期进行安全审计和漏洞扫描,确保系统的安全性。
问题3:促销活动后如何处理可能出现的技术支持高峰?
解决方案:
- 提前增加技术支持团队的规模和能力。
- 利用自动化工具和自助服务门户减轻人工支持的压力。
- 建立有效的沟通渠道,及时收集和响应用户反馈。
示例代码(假设使用Spring Cloud构建微服务)
@SpringBootApplication
@EnableDiscoveryClient
public class MyMicroserviceApplication {
public static void main(String[] args) {
SpringApplication.run(MyMicroserviceApplication.class, args);
}
}
这段代码展示了如何使用Spring Cloud启动一个微服务应用,并启用服务发现功能,这是跨部署微服务平台中的一个关键组件。
通过以上信息,您可以更好地理解跨部署微服务平台的基础概念、优势、应用场景以及年末促销可能带来的影响和相关问题的解决方案。